Genesis Hopeful Haven Inc

Organization Overview

Genesis Hopeful Haven Inc is located in Cutler Bay, FL. The organization was established in 2014. According to its NTEE Classification (P20) the organization is classified as: Human Service Organizations, under the broad grouping of Human Services and related organizations. As of 10/2023, Genesis Hopeful Haven Inc employed 11 individuals.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Genesis Hopeful Haven Inc is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.

For the year ending 10/2023, Genesis Hopeful Haven Inc generated $1.2m in total revenue. This organization has experienced exceptional growth, as over the past 6 years, it has increased revenue by an average of 31.4% each year . All expenses for the organization totaled $1.3m during the year ending 10/2023. While expenses have increased by 32.8% per year over the past 6 years. They've been increasing with an increasing level of total revenue.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.

Describe the Organization's Mission:

Part 3 - Line 1

STRENGTHEN THE LIVES OF YOUTH IN FOSTER CARE THROUGH SUPPORTIVE HOUSING AND PROGRAMS THAT PROMOTE HOPE, HEALING AND INDEPENDENCE.

Describe the Organization's Program Activity:

Part 3 - Line 4a

RESIDENTIAL/HOUSING PROGRAM: GHH PROVIDES HOUSING FOR CLIENTS WHO ARE AGING OUT OF THE FOSTER CARE SYSTEM AND WHO OTHERWISE WOULD NOT HAVE A HOME. A FAMILY-LIKE ENVIRONMENT IS OF PARAMOUNT IMPORTANCE. HOUSING SPECIALIST, CHECKS IN ON RESIDENTS, AND HAS WEEKLY MEETINGS TO MAKE SURE BENCHMARK GOALS ARE BEING MET. MENTORING, SHARED MEALS, CELEBRATIONS (FOR EXAMPLE, BIRTHDAYS AND GRADUATIONS) AND OUTINGS ARE INTEGRAL TO PROVIDING A FAMILY-LIKE, SUPPORTIVE ENVIRONMENT.


EXPLORERS PROGRAM: CLIENTS GO ON SUPERVISED TRIPS AROUND THE U.S., INCLUDING THE SMOKY MOUNTAINS, THE ROCKIES, MAINE AND THE BAHAMAS, GIVING THEM AN OPPORTUNITY TO EXPERIENCE OTHER ENVIRONMENTS AND REGIONS. MANY HAVE NEVER BEEN OUT OF FLORIDA OR ON A PLANE.COMMUNITY OUTREACH PROGRAM: GHH ORGANIZES EVENTS FOR THE FOSTER CARE FAMILIES IN THE LOCAL COMMUNITY IN PARTNERSHIP WITH OTHER NON-PROFITS. CHRISTMAS, EASTER, FOSTER CARE AWARENESS ARE A FEW EXAMPLES.


DAY CAMP PROGRAM: GHH PROVIDES EIGHT WEEK PROGRAM DURING THE SUMMER, TWO WEEKS EACH FOR WINTER AND SPRING BREAK, HELD AT GHH COMMUNITY CENTER. CAMPERS PARTICIPATE IN A VARIETY OF ON-SITE ACTIVITIES BASED ON AGE AND INTEREST, GO ON FIELD TRIPS, INCLUDING WEEKLY VISITS TO A COMMUNITY POOL TO SWIM. ALL TRANSPORTATION AND MEALS ARE PROVIDED.


AFTER-SCHOOL ENRICHMENT PROGRAM: PARTICIPANTS COME AFTER SCHOOL TO THE COMMUNITY CENTER FOR LIFE SKILLS CLASSES, ACADEMIC SUPPORT (E.G. TUTORING, COLLEGE TEST PREP), AND FITNESS.
